Comparison Analysis

Grand Valley State University graduates earn more than Northern Michigan University graduates. Specifically, Grand Valley State University graduates earn $47,840, while Northern Michigan University graduates earn $37,996. Grand Valley State University also has a higher graduation rate, at 67.4% compared to Northern Michigan University's 51.8%. Grand Valley State University has a significantly higher acceptance rate, at 94.7%, than Northern Michigan University's 70%.

Northern Michigan University has lower tuition costs. The tuition at Northern Michigan University is $13,304, while the tuition at Grand Valley State University is $14,628.

When considering the value proposition, Grand Valley State University appears to offer a better return on investment due to higher graduate earnings and a higher graduation rate, despite the slightly higher tuition. Prospective students may consider their likelihood of acceptance, as Grand Valley State University is much more accessible.
